	// Test suites from RFC #1321

	void testRFC1321_1() {

		INIT_DIGEST(algo, "md5");

		algo->update("");
		algo->finalize();

		VASSERT_EQ("*", "d41d8cd98f00b204e9800998ecf8427e", algo->getHexDigest());
	}

	void testRFC1321_2() {

		INIT_DIGEST(algo, "md5");

		algo->update("a");
		algo->finalize();

		VASSERT_EQ("*", "0cc175b9c0f1b6a831c399e269772661", algo->getHexDigest());
	}

	void testRFC1321_3() {

		INIT_DIGEST(algo, "md5");

		algo->update("abc");
		algo->finalize();

		VASSERT_EQ("*", "900150983cd24fb0d6963f7d28e17f72", algo->getHexDigest());
	}

	void testRFC1321_4() {

		INIT_DIGEST(algo, "md5");

		algo->update("message digest");
		algo->finalize();

		VASSERT_EQ("*", "f96b697d7cb7938d525a2f31aaf161d0", algo->getHexDigest());
	}

	void testRFC1321_5() {

		INIT_DIGEST(algo, "md5");

		algo->update("abcdefghijklmnopqrstuvwxyz");
		algo->finalize();

		VASSERT_EQ("*", "c3fcd3d76192e4007dfb496cca67e13b", algo->getHexDigest());
	}

	void testRFC1321_6() {

		INIT_DIGEST(algo, "md5");

		algo->update("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789");
		algo->finalize();

		VASSERT_EQ("*", "d174ab98d277d9f5a5611c2c9f419d9f", algo->getHexDigest());
	}

	void testRFC1321_7() {

		INIT_DIGEST(algo, "md5");

		algo->update("12345678901234567890123456789012345678901234567890123456789012345678901234567890");
		algo->finalize();

		VASSERT_EQ("*", "57edf4a22be3c955ac49da2e2107b67a", algo->getHexDigest());
	}
